What is it?
A pair of antique French earrings from around about the 1920s. These earrings are made from 18ct yellow gold. They each feature a gold bead detail at the centre, a linear textured detail and geometric repeated square shapes. They have a maker's mark Charles Garnier, a Parisian Jeweller that started their activity in 1924. The mark is a "C" and a "G" with a club sign between the two
